Leigh Ingham

Leigh Ingham is the Labour MP for Stafford, and has been an MP continually since 4 July 2024.

Registered Interests

The Register of Members’ Financial Interests is updated fortnightly online when the House is sitting, and less frequently at other times. Interests remain in the Register for twelve months after the interest has ended.

The interests set out below are those included in the most recently published version of the Register. View current and previous versions of the Register.

An interest with rectification details indicates it has been subject to an investigation by the Parliamentary Commissioner for Standards and subsequently rectified.
